This is an image of a kelp forest. All BUT ONE is a characteristic of kelp and kelp forests on the west coast of North America.

That is:
A) Kelp are large brown algae.
B) Kelp live in cool, relatively shallow waters close to the shore.
C) Kelp forests form in deep, open waters and are found at depths greater than 130 feet.
D) Aquatic organisms use the thick blades in a kelp forest as a shelter for their young from predators in the area.

Which of the following is a type of tissue in plants that is dead at maturity?
victus00 [196]

Answer:

The correct answer will be option-B.

Explanation:

The plant tissues are composed of three types of cells: parenchyma, collenchyma and sclerenchyma.

The parenchyma and collenchyma remain alive at their maturity but sclerenchyma loses their protoplasm and become dead. These cells deposit lignin in their secondary walls and form hard tissues of the plant-like hard shell of a coconut. Sclerenchyma provides mechanical strength to the plant.

Thus, Option-B is the correct answer.
